Understanding DevOps: The Core Principles

Before diving into benefits, it’s crucial to grasp what DevOps entails. At its core, DevOps is a set of practices that emphasize collaboration between development and operations teams, enabling them to work together throughout the entire software application lifecycle. The goal is to shorten the development cycle, increase deployment frequency, and deliver high-quality software more reliably.

Key principles of DevOps include:

  • Collaboration: Breaking down silos between teams to enhance communication and transparency.
  • Automation: Streamlining repetitive processes to reduce manual errors and save time.
  • Continuous Integration/Continuous Deployment (CI/CD): Automating the testing and deployment processes, which promotes a more agile development environment.
  • Monitoring and Feedback: Prioritizing real-time feedback to improve future iterations, ensuring the product evolves with user needs.

1. Accelerated Time-to-Market

One of the most significant advantages of implementing DevOps practices is the acceleration of time-to-market. With the increasing demand for rapid innovation, businesses need to deliver products to market faster than ever. DevOps facilitates this by introducing contin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D) practices. This approach allows teams to deploy code changes more frequently, reduce release cycles, and respond quickly to market changes.

For example, by automating testing and deployment processes, companies can ensure that software is released with minimal delays while maintaining high quality. The faster a company can launch its products, the sooner it can receive customer feedback, iterate on its offerings, and maintain a competitive edge.

3. Improved Software Quality

Quality assurance is fundamental to any software development venture, and DevOps significantly enhances this aspect. By incorporating automated testing within the CI/CD pipeline, teams can identify and rectify issues early in the development cycle. This proactive approach allows for more robust and reliable software releases, reducing the likelihood of bugs or performance issues post-launch.

Moreover, the continuous monitoring and feedback loops characteristic of DevOps ensure that teams consistently evaluate their software’s performance. This ongoing assessment promotes a culture of quality and allows teams to adapt quickly based on user feedback and evolving requirements.

4. Cost Efficiency

DevOps practices can lead to substantial cost savings for companies engaged in software development. The efficiencies achieved through automation can significantly reduce the time and resources needed for various stages of the software development lifecycle. Automation minimizes manual tasks, which not only cuts costs but also frees up valuable time for teams to focus on higher-value activities.

Furthermore, by improving software quality and reducing the time spent troubleshooting and fixing bugs, organizations can reallocate funds to other strategic initiatives, such as research and development or enhancing user experience.

5. Continuous Monitoring and Improvement

Another critical benefit of DevOps is the emphasis on continuous monitoring and improvement. By integrating monitoring tools into the deployment pipeline, teams can gather real-time data on application performance and user interactions. This data becomes invaluable for making informed decisions regarding future updates and feature enhancements.

Continuous improvement is essential for staying relevant in a competitive landscape. Businesses must be able to pivot based on user feedback and market dynamics. DevOps facilitates this agility by enabling teams to iterate quickly and deliver updates more frequently—transforming customer feedback into actionable improvements.
